Skip to content

Commit a659e82

Browse files
Merge pull request #114 from katilingban:dev
add brewer palettes to ACDC and NHS vignettes; fix #110; fix #113
2 parents 310ad84 + 7cf629f commit a659e82

File tree

4 files changed

+480
-35
lines changed

4 files changed

+480
-35
lines changed

R/theme_acdc.R

Lines changed: 20 additions & 21 deletions
Original file line numberDiff line numberDiff line change
@@ -118,34 +118,32 @@ acdc_palettes <- list(
118118
#'
119119
acdc_brewer_palettes <- list(
120120
blues = rev(c(acdc_blue, acdc_blue_grey, acdc_palettes$acdc_blues[2])),
121-
bugn = c(acdc_blue, acdc_lime, acdc_teal),
121+
bugn = c(acdc_blue, acdc_lime),
122122
bupu = c(acdc_blue, acdc_blue_grey, acdc_purple),
123-
gnbu = c(acdc_teal, acdc_lime, acdc_blue),
123+
gnbu = c(acdc_lime, acdc_blue),
124124
pubu = c(acdc_purple, acdc_blue_grey, acdc_blue),
125-
pubugn = c(acdc_purple, acdc_blue, acdc_lime),
126-
purd = c(acdc_purple, acdc_plum, acdc_pink),
127-
rdpu = c(acdc_red, acdc_pink, acdc_purple),
128-
ylgn = c(acdc_amber, acdc_teal, acdc_green),
129-
ylgnbu = c(acdc_amber, acdc_lime, acdc_blue),
125+
pubugn = c(acdc_purple, acdc_blue, acdc_green),
126+
ylgn = c(acdc_amber, acdc_green),
127+
ylgnbu = c(acdc_amber, acdc_green, acdc_blue),
130128
ylorrd = c(acdc_amber, acdc_deep_orange, acdc_red),
131-
piylgn = c(acdc_pink, acdc_amber, acdc_lime),
129+
piylgn = c(acdc_pink, acdc_amber, acdc_green),
132130
prgn = c(acdc_purple, acdc_mauve, acdc_green),
133131
puor = c(acdc_purple, acdc_amber, acdc_deep_orange),
134-
rdbu = c(acdc_red, acdc_plum, acdc_blue),
132+
rdbu = c(acdc_red, acdc_blue),
135133
rdylbu = c(acdc_red, acdc_amber, acdc_blue),
136-
rdylgn = c(acdc_red, acdc_amber, acdc_lime),
134+
rdylgn = c(acdc_red, acdc_amber, acdc_green),
137135
pastel1 = c(
138-
acdc_palettes$acdc_blues[3],
139-
acdc_palettes$acdc_plums[3],
140-
acdc_palettes$acdc_blue_grey[3],
141-
acdc_palettes$acdc_amber[3],
142-
acdc_palettes$acdc_cyan[3],
143-
acdc_palettes$acdc_deep_orange[3],
144-
acdc_palettes$acdc_purple[3],
145-
acdc_palettes$acdc_lime[3],
146-
acdc_palettes$acdc_mauve[3],
147-
acdc_palettes$acdc_pink[3],
148-
acdc_palettes$acdc_teal[3]
136+
acdc_palettes$acdc_blues[4],
137+
acdc_palettes$acdc_plums[4],
138+
acdc_palettes$acdc_blue_grey[4],
139+
acdc_palettes$acdc_amber[4],
140+
acdc_palettes$acdc_cyan[4],
141+
acdc_palettes$acdc_deep_orange[4],
142+
acdc_palettes$acdc_purple[4],
143+
acdc_palettes$acdc_lime[4],
144+
acdc_palettes$acdc_mauve[4],
145+
acdc_palettes$acdc_pink[4],
146+
acdc_palettes$acdc_teal[4]
149147
),
150148
pastel2 = c(
151149
acdc_palettes$acdc_blues[2],
@@ -178,6 +176,7 @@ acdc_fonts <- list(
178176
acdc_arial = "Arial"
179177
)
180178

179+
181180
#'
182181
#' Set ACDC font to use based on what is available from the system
183182
#'

R/theme_nhs.R

Lines changed: 14 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-145,27 +145,27 @@ nhs_palettes <- list(
145145
#'
146146

147147
nhs_brewer_palettes <- list(
148-
blues = c(nhs_light_blue, nhs_blue, nhs_bright_blue),
149-
bugn = c(nhs_light_blue, nhs_aqua_green, nhs_green),
148+
blues = c(nhs_light_blue, nhs_bright_blue, nhs_dark_blue),
149+
bugn = c(nhs_dark_blue, nhs_dark_green),
150150
bupu = c(nhs_dark_blue, nhs_dark_pink, nhs_purple),
151-
gnbu = c(nhs_aqua_green, nhs_aqua_blue, nhs_bright_blue),
151+
gnbu = c(nhs_dark_green, nhs_dark_blue),
152152
greens = c(nhs_light_green, nhs_green, nhs_dark_green),
153153
greys = c(nhs_pale_grey, nhs_mid_grey, nhs_dark_grey),
154-
pubu = c(nhs_purple, nhs_dark_pink, nhs_dark_blue),
155-
pubugn = c(nhs_purple, nhs_blue, nhs_green),
156-
purd = c(nhs_purple, nhs_dark_pink, nhs_dark_red),
157-
rdpu = c(nhs_dark_red, nhs_dark_pink, nhs_purple),
158-
reds = c(nhs_emergency_red, nhs_pink, nhs_dark_red),
159-
ylgn = c(nhs_yellow, nhs_aqua_green, nhs_dark_green),
160-
ylgnbu = c(nhs_yellow, nhs_aqua_blue, nhs_dark_blue),
154+
pubu = c(nhs_purple, nhs_dark_blue),
155+
pubugn = c(nhs_purple, nhs_dark_blue, nhs_dark_green),
156+
purd = c(nhs_purple, nhs_emergency_red),
157+
rdpu = c(nhs_emergency_red, nhs_purple),
158+
reds = c(nhs_emergency_red, nhs_dark_red),
159+
ylgn = c(nhs_yellow, nhs_dark_green),
160+
ylgnbu = c(nhs_yellow, nhs_dark_green, nhs_dark_blue),
161161
ylorrd = c(nhs_yellow, nhs_orange, nhs_dark_red),
162162
piylgn = c(nhs_pink, nhs_yellow, nhs_green),
163163
prgn = c(nhs_purple, nhs_pink, nhs_dark_green),
164164
puor = c(nhs_purple, nhs_emergency_red, nhs_orange),
165-
rdbu = c(nhs_dark_red, nhs_purple, nhs_dark_blue),
166-
rdgy = c(nhs_dark_red, nhs_emergency_red, nhs_mid_grey),
167-
rdylbu = c(nhs_emergency_red, nhs_yellow, nhs_bright_blue),
168-
rdylgn = c(nhs_emergency_red, nhs_yellow, nhs_green),
165+
rdbu = c(nhs_dark_red, nhs_emergency_red, nhs_dark_blue),
166+
rdgy = c(nhs_dark_red, nhs_mid_grey, nhs_dark_grey),
167+
rdylbu = c(nhs_dark_red, nhs_yellow, nhs_dark_blue),
168+
rdylgn = c(nhs_dark_red, nhs_yellow, nhs_dark_green),
169169
pastel1 = c(
170170
nhs_palettes$nhs_light_blues[3], nhs_palettes$nhs_bright_blues[3],
171171
nhs_palettes$nhs_greens[3], nhs_palettes$nhs_light_greens[3],

vignettes/africa-cdc.Rmd

Lines changed: 192 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-130,6 +130,198 @@ structure(acdc_palettes$acdc_pinks, class = "palette", name = "Africa CDC Pinks"
130130
structure(acdc_palettes$acdc_teals, class = "palette", name = "Africa CDC Teals")
131131
```
132132

133+
## Africa CDC sequential brewer palettes
134+
135+
### Blues
136+
137+
```{r acdc-blues-sequential, echo = FALSE, fig.alt = "Africa CDC sequential blues palette", fig.align = "center", fig.height = 1}
138+
structure(
139+
paleta_create_brewer(n = 9, name = "blues", org = "acdc"),
140+
class = "palette",
141+
name = "Africa CDC Sequential Blues"
142+
)
143+
```
144+
145+
### Blue to green
146+
147+
```{r acdc-blue-green-sequential, echo = FALSE, fig.alt = "Africa CDC sequential blue to green palette", fig.align = "center", fig.height = 1}
148+
structure(
149+
paleta_create_brewer(n = 9, name = "bugn", org = "acdc"),
150+
class = "palette",
151+
name = "Africa CDC Sequential Blue to Green"
152+
)
153+
```
154+
155+
### Blue to purple
156+
157+
```{r acdc-blue-purple-sequential, echo = FALSE, fig.alt = "Africa CDC sequential blue to purple palette", fig.align = "center", fig.height = 1}
158+
structure(
159+
paleta_create_brewer(n = 9, name = "bupu", org = "acdc"),
160+
class = "palette",
161+
name = "Africa CDC Sequential Blue to Purple"
162+
)
163+
```
164+
165+
### Green to blue
166+
167+
```{r acdc-green-blue-sequential, echo = FALSE, fig.alt = "Africa CDC sequential green to blue palette", fig.align = "center", fig.height = 1}
168+
structure(
169+
paleta_create_brewer(n = 9, name = "gnbu", org = "acdc"),
170+
class = "palette",
171+
name = "Africa CDC Sequential Green to Blue"
172+
)
173+
```
174+
175+
### Purple to blue
176+
177+
```{r acdc-purple-blue-sequential, echo = FALSE, fig.alt = "Africa CDC sequential purple to blue palette", fig.align = "center", fig.height = 1}
178+
structure(
179+
paleta_create_brewer(n = 9, name = "pubu", org = "acdc"),
180+
class = "palette",
181+
name = "Africa CDC Sequential Purple to Blue"
182+
)
183+
```
184+
185+
### Purple to blue to green
186+
187+
```{r acdc-purple-blue-green-sequential, echo = FALSE, fig.alt = "Africa CDC sequential purple to blue to green palette", fig.align = "center", fig.height = 1}
188+
structure(
189+
paleta_create_brewer(n = 9, name = "pubugn", org = "acdc"),
190+
class = "palette",
191+
name = "Africa CDC Sequential Purple to Blue to Green"
192+
)
193+
```
194+
195+
### Yellow to green
196+
197+
```{r acdc-yellow-green-sequential, echo = FALSE, fig.alt = "Africa CDC sequential yellow to green palette", fig.align = "center", fig.height = 1}
198+
structure(
199+
paleta_create_brewer(n = 9, name = "ylgn", org = "acdc"),
200+
class = "palette",
201+
name = "Africa CDC Sequential Yellow to Green"
202+
)
203+
```
204+
205+
### Yellow to green to blue
206+
207+
```{r acdc-yellow-green-blue-sequential, echo = FALSE, fig.alt = "Africa CDC sequential yellow to green to blue palette", fig.align = "center", fig.height = 1}
208+
structure(
209+
paleta_create_brewer(n = 9, name = "ylgnbu", org = "acdc"),
210+
class = "palette",
211+
name = "Africa CDC Sequential Yellow to Green to Blue"
212+
)
213+
```
214+
215+
### Yellow to orange to red
216+
217+
```{r acdc-yellow-orange-red-sequential, echo = FALSE, fig.alt = "Africa CDC sequential yellow to orange to red palette", fig.align = "center", fig.height = 1}
218+
structure(
219+
paleta_create_brewer(n = 9, name = "ylorrd", org = "acdc"),
220+
class = "palette",
221+
name = "Africa CDC Sequential Yellow to Orange to Red"
222+
)
223+
```
224+
225+
## Africa CDC divergent brewer palettes
226+
227+
### Pink to yellow to green
228+
229+
```{r acdc-pink-yellow-green-sequential, echo = FALSE, fig.alt = "Africa CDC sequential pink to yellow to green palette", fig.align = "center", fig.height = 1}
230+
structure(
231+
paleta_create_brewer(
232+
n = 11, name = "piylgn", org = "acdc", type = "divergent"
233+
),
234+
class = "palette",
235+
name = "Africa CDC Sequential Pink to Yellow to Green"
236+
)
237+
```
238+
239+
### Purple to green
240+
241+
```{r acdc-purple-green-sequential, echo = FALSE, fig.alt = "Africa CDC sequential purple to green palette", fig.align = "center", fig.height = 1}
242+
structure(
243+
paleta_create_brewer(
244+
n = 11, name = "prgn", org = "acdc", type = "divergent"
245+
),
246+
class = "palette",
247+
name = "Africa CDC Sequential Purple to Green"
248+
)
249+
```
250+
251+
### Purple to orange
252+
253+
```{r acdc-purple-orange-sequential, echo = FALSE, fig.alt = "Africa CDC sequential purple to orange palette", fig.align = "center", fig.height = 1}
254+
structure(
255+
paleta_create_brewer(
256+
n = 11, name = "puor", org = "acdc", type = "divergent"
257+
),
258+
class = "palette",
259+
name = "Africa CDC Sequential Purple to Orange"
260+
)
261+
```
262+
263+
### Red to blue
264+
265+
```{r acdc-red-blue-sequential, echo = FALSE, fig.alt = "Africa CDC sequential red to blue palette", fig.align = "center", fig.height = 1}
266+
structure(
267+
paleta_create_brewer(
268+
n = 11, name = "rdbu", org = "acdc", type = "divergent"
269+
),
270+
class = "palette",
271+
name = "Africa CDC Sequential Red to Blue"
272+
)
273+
```
274+
275+
### Red to yellow to blue
276+
277+
```{r acdc-red-yellow-blue-sequential, echo = FALSE, fig.alt = "Africa CDC sequential red to yellow to blue palette", fig.align = "center", fig.height = 1}
278+
structure(
279+
paleta_create_brewer(
280+
n = 11, name = "rdylbu", org = "acdc", type = "divergent"
281+
),
282+
class = "palette",
283+
name = "Africa CDC Sequential Red to Yellow to Blue"
284+
)
285+
```
286+
287+
### Red to yellow to green
288+
289+
```{r acdc-red-yellow-green-sequential, echo = FALSE, fig.alt = "Africa CDC sequential red to yellow to green palette", fig.align = "center", fig.height = 1}
290+
structure(
291+
paleta_create_brewer(
292+
n = 11, name = "rdylgn", org = "acdc", type = "divergent"
293+
),
294+
class = "palette",
295+
name = "Africa CDC Sequential Red to Yellow to Green"
296+
)
297+
```
298+
299+
## Africa CDC qualitative palettes
300+
301+
### Pastel set 1
302+
303+
```{r acdc-pastel1-qualitative, echo = FALSE, fig.alt = "Africa CDC qualitative pastel set 1 palette", fig.align = "center", fig.height = 1}
304+
structure(
305+
paleta_create_brewer(
306+
n = 11, name = "pastel1", org = "acdc", type = "qualitative"
307+
),
308+
class = "palette",
309+
name = "Africa CDC Qualitative Pastel Set 1"
310+
)
311+
```
312+
313+
### Pastel set 2
314+
315+
```{r acdc-pastel2-qualitative, echo = FALSE, fig.alt = "Africa CDC qualitative pastel set 2 palette", fig.align = "center", fig.height = 1}
316+
structure(
317+
paleta_create_brewer(
318+
n = 11, name = "pastel2", org = "acdc", type = "qualitative"
319+
),
320+
class = "palette",
321+
name = "Africa CDC Qualitative Pastel Set 2"
322+
)
323+
```
324+
133325
## Africa CDC `ggplot2` theme
134326

135327
### Africa CDC light theme

0 commit comments

Comments
 (0)